Community Problem Oriented Policing

Community Problem Oriented Policing (CPOP) — A philosophy and methodology designed to tackle community problems through a partnership between the employees of the City and the residents of Cincinnati.

City employees and the community work together, under the direction of the Cincinnati Police utilizing a consistent process of Scanning, Analysis, Response and Assessment (SARA) to resolve problems. Problems are defined as two or more incidents that are similar in nature, that cause or are capable of causing harm, and the community wants the police to do something to resolve them.
